Trucking accidents are shockingly common

In a survey of truck drivers, one third said they were involved in at least one serious crash.


Trucking accidents can be the result of various acts of negligence by trucking companies and their drivers.

  • Allowing or encouraging drivers to violate hour and sleep rules
  • Encouraging reckless driving for the sake of company profits
  • Overloaded or improperly loaded vehicles
  • Poor vehicle maintenance
  • Inadequate training

Examples of truck driver negligence:

  • Distracted driving
  • Driving under the influence of drugs or alcohol
  • Speeding
  • Failure to obey traffic signals or rules
  • Texting while driving
  • Not complying with Department of Transportation hours of service regulations

Why are trucking accidents so dangerous?

Due to the substantial weight and size of commercial trucks, these collisions result in significant injuries and death. In 2020, trucking accidents took the lives of nearly 5,000 people and injured 107,000 more.

In the vast majority of crashes, the fatalities were the occupants of the other vehicles.
